We've been talking about the Diels-Alder reaction this whole time, but it's just one example of a cycloaddition, a type of ring-forming reaction where two new bonds form simultaneously.
Cycloadditions are classified by counting the number of carbons in the pi system in each reactant, so the Diels Alder is a cycloaddition.
The pyrimidine dimers we saw at the beginning of the episode are a cycloaddition, and we can draw arrows for the mechanism like this.
